How is expected goals (xG) calculated?
xG is calculated shot by shot: every shot gets a scoring probability between 0 and 1, and those values are summed for the team's match xG.
- Every shot gets a value between 0 and 1 — the estimated probability that an average player scores from that situation.
- The value depends on the chance — distance and angle to goal, body part (foot vs head), whether it was a one-on-one, the type of assist, and more.
- Sum the shots to get a team's match xG.
A tap-in from the six-yard box might be worth 0.7 xG; a speculative 30-yard effort 0.03. If a team's shots add up to 2.3, its xG is 2.3 — regardless of whether it scored zero or four.
What does an xG of 2.3 mean?
An xG of 2.3 means the chances a team created were collectively worth about 2.3 goals against an average finisher — independent of how many it actually scored. The gap between goals scored and xG shows over- or under-performance:
| Scenario | Goals scored | xG | Interpretation |
|---|---|---|---|
| Underperformed | 1 | 2.3 | Bad finishing, good goalkeeping, or variance |
| Overperformed | 4 | 2.3 | Clinical finishing or favourable variance |
xG is most useful over many matches, where finishing luck evens out, rather than from a single game. That is why analysts treat a one-off xG gap with caution.
Why do AI models and analysts use xG?
xG separates process (chance creation) from outcome (goals), which can be noisy — so it can reveal when a result does not reflect the underlying performance. A team can lose 1–0 while generating 2.5 xG to 0.4, a sign the scoreline may flatter the opponent.

What is the difference between xG and goals?
Goals are what actually went in; xG estimates how many goals the chances were worth — the table below contrasts them.
| Metric | What it measures | When it's known | Why it differs |
|---|---|---|---|
| Goals | The actual balls that crossed the line | Known at full time | The literal result |
| xG | Average goals the chances created were worth | Estimated post-match from shot quality | Driven by finishing, goalkeeping, and variance |
The gap between the two is what shows over- or under-performance over time.
